How is ptosis formed?

The droopy eyelid is a condition provoked by weak eye muscle. Another reason is hiding in the nerve that is controlling this muscle, he can stop working due to some damage. This could happen because of infection, injury or some health condition, like a congenital defect, stroke, diabetes, tumours or myasthenia gravis. Some children may develop ptosis that is followed by lazy eye but as soon as they cope with the ptosis, lazy eye improves. Ptosis surgery has some side effects so most people don’t hurry up with the decision. For example, there might be a swelling, or infection right after the surgery. Depending on the surgeon the eyelid might not be positioned right so this is a risky touch.
